Proclaims

Verb / prəʊˈkleɪmz / Another word for proclaims — explore alternatives below. For syllable breakdowns and pronunciation, see this word on Syllablesworld.

Definition

To announce or declare something publicly or officially.

Example sentences

  1. The king proclaims a day of celebration for his people.
  2. She proclaims her innocence in the crime.
  3. The news anchor proclaims the latest headlines to the viewers.
  4. He proclaims his faith in God to all who will listen.
  5. The mayor proclaims the new city park open to the public.
